In the vast universe of theological literature, few works manage to bridge the gap between rigorous academic scholarship and practical, everyday Bible study. One such gem that has gained a quiet but powerful reputation among Spanish-speaking Christians and theologians is "Claves de Interpretación Bíblica" (Keys to Biblical Interpretation) by Tomás de la Fuente.
Claves de Interpretación Bíblica is considered his magnum opus in the field of hermeneutics. It was written to answer one simple question: How can a normal Christian read the Bible correctly without falling into errors of literalism, allegory, or personal bias? The "claves," or keys, that de la Fuente provides are essentially tools for historical and literary empathy. One of his most compelling arguments involves the concept of Sitz im Leben (a German phrase meaning "setting in life" that he adopts). He insists that no verse can be properly understood unless we reconstruct the community that produced it. Why does Leviticus seem obsessed with purity laws? Because it was written for a nomadic tribe trying to survive disease and distinguish itself from pagan neighbors. Why do the Gospels present different chronologies of the Last Supper? Because John is writing a theological meditation on Jesus as the Passover Lamb, while Mark is compiling a rapid-fire memoir.
